Laois man charged with making gain by deception

A MAN who allegedly took a €3,500 deposit in exchange for promising to supply a landscaping service appeared at Portlaoise District Court last week charged with making gain by deception.

Michael O’Reilly (33), Main Road, Clonkeen, Portlaoise, was charged with the offence that allegedly took place at a property at The Avenue, Mount Stewart, Portlaoise on dates between 24-25 July last year.

Garda Sgt Jason Hughes applied to remand the defendant on continuing bail to allow time for the director of public prosecutions (DPP) to give directions on how the case should proceed (at district or circuit court level).

Judge Fay remanded Mr O’Reilly on continuing bail to the 13 July sitting of the court for DPP directions and assigned free legal aid to his solicitor Josephine Fitzpatrick.
